Abstract

The phenomenon of unclear ownership status of inherited items from Islamic boarding schools (pesantren) often leads to ownership conflicts, especially when the items are reclaimed after a long time. This study aims to analyze the legal status of ownership of inherited items from Islamic boarding schools (pesantren) in Al-Qur'aniyy, Gajah City, Central Lampung, from the perspective of Islamic economic law. This study uses a qualitative method with a normative approach, through observation, interviews, and documentation techniques. The results show that items left by students remain private property until a valid contract is made in the form of a gift or wadi'ah. However, in practice, many students do not explicitly convey their intention to own, so that the pillars of the contract, such as ijab and qabul, are not fulfilled. The implication of this ambiguity is the potential for violations of ownership rights and misuse of assets. Therefore, written administrative policies and education related to Islamic contracts are needed to ensure the clarity of the status of items and realize the principle of Hifzh al-Mal in the maqashid sharia.
